Hello to everyone!
I am a mom of wonderful 3 yo boy who has yet not been diagnosed, however Im now almost sure he must be somewhere on a spectrum. He started to attend a childminder setting in January and from the beginning I was told he might have some "issues"...Now we are waiting for his childminders to write a report and sent it to his GP and health visitor...When i look back i could always described my son as a very serious and a little bit "detached" ,but i thought it was just his character, his speech was also a little bit delayed , at the age of two he knew around 30 words , but I was told its due to him being bilingual, myself and his dad come frome Poland , and since he was born I talked to him in both languages. When my boy was around two and a half we went to Poland for a week and then suddenly his speech got so much better, he started to join words and reapiting whole sentences. As I mentioned above the trouble has started in January at a childminder setting , and when his childminder pointed the issues I could see its nothing new ,but I always thought there was nothing to worry about. Well in a few words my son struggles to keep eye contact, he would not play with any other children and could be agressive, he can be kind to children ,but then suddenly he can change and hit them ,like for him there was no difference between these behaviors... His speech is also particular, he can built simple sentences on his own but mostly he comunicate using the sentences he heard before, he mastered it to perfection though and use those sentences apropriate to the situation, for example when he wants play with hoover he would say "want to play with hoover? So get a hoover darlinging" and he struggles to simply reply with a "yes" or "no" and repeats most questions he is asked. Speaking of hoover...hoover is my son's grant obsession :-) he can play with hoover for hours, he talks about it all the time , he also loves aiplanes and its becase i told him that airplane's engines are a large hoovers...I can see that he isnt comfortable at all In a new situations and with more people around he seems to shut off , on playgrounds he would stay on the side and play with a gate rather then use any other equipment, there is only one playground he likes and feels comfortable on, even when its packed with children. At the top of everything, sometimes he could not recognise or greet me or his father or other people he knows, ithese situations he behaves like he literally doesnt see that person , even though they are talking to him and trying to say hello and catch his attention. He also would not usually respond to demands, have a lots of tuntrums and meltdowns and likes his routine unchanged , he also have a few sensory issues..

Appart from that he is happy,loving and curious little boy , he constantly makes a progress and can trully amaze me, like when a couple of weeks ago he learned to us a potty within one day. He is very independent and wants to do most of the things on his own.

Sorry for such a long post , I just tried to described my lo the best I could as we still haven't been diagnosed.
I came here for support as Im a single mom and I struggle a lot sometimes ,also I just need to uderstand what is going on with my son to help him as much as I can. At the moment I only know that I wouldnt change a thing about him, hi is perfect to me but i am afraid sometimes of his future and I really want him to be happy.
